Abstract
Systems and methods for improving operation of a hybrid vehicle are presented. In one example, torque output of a motor is controlled to include a reserve torque for starting an engine that may be selectively coupled to the motor. Additionally, the motor torque compensates for disconnect clutch closing.

5. A method for operating a hybrid driveline, comprising:
-
in response an increase in driver demand torque, supplying torque to the hybrid driveline up to a first driver demand torque limit, the first driver demand torque limit based on a maximum torque from a motor minus engine starting torque; starting an engine via the motor in response to the driver demand torque exceeding the first driver demand torque limit; and supplying torque to the hybrid driveline greater than the first driver demand torque limit in response to a speed of the engine being within a predetermined speed of a speed of the motor. - View Dependent Claims (6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11)

12. A hybrid vehicle system, comprising:
-
an engine; a motor selectively coupled to the engine via a driveline disconnect clutch; and a controller including non-transitory instructions executable to start the engine in response to a desired driver demand torque being within a threshold torque of a first driver demand torque limit, the first driver demand torque limit based on maximum torque from the motor minus engine starting torque, and additional instructions to increase the first driver demand torque limit after the driveline disconnect clutch is fully closed.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16)
